Overview
The Graduate Certificate in Outdoor Education is designed for educators interested in attaining the necessary skills and competencies to effectively teach outdoor education in a school or training setting. Outdoor Education draws on the disciplines of experiential education, adventure education, environmental education, social science and the humanities.
Subjects are delivered flexibly, i.e. require attendance at weekend activities on or near the Wollongong campus.
Entry Requirements
Entry is available to candidates who satisfy the University's entry requirements for Graduate Certificates (i.e. a three-year degree or equivalent).
Course Requirements
Students must complete four compulsory subjects totalling 24 credit points from the list below.
